Choose the Right Beginner Golf Equipment with these Tips
Beginners need a lot less golf equipment than they realize on average. There are a lot of fancy gadgets that look fun to try but you won't need those until you've learned the game more. Until then, you really can't benefit from some of the more advanced pieces of golf equipment anyway. As you pick out your starter kit, keep these important tools in mind.
A golf ball cleaning kit will get you off to a great start. Your golf balls will get unbelievably messy during a game. While dirty golf balls may seem like a trivial concern, clumps of dirt and debris not only affect how well the ball flies toward the green but also how well it rolls once it gets there. Every aspect of your game can be impacted by having a dirty golf ball. This will allow you to save money by not having to throw out your balls after every game and start with a new one at every game and will also help improve your game.

The next thing you want to invest in is a good quality putter. Woods and drivers get focused on by most people who are hoping to get extra distance. You will be able to really take your game to the next level if you focus more on your short game, the strokes that take place on or near the green. After you test out a few putters at a golf store to see which loft, shaft length, and grip you prefer best, you can compare prices online so you get the best deal.
Finally, you need to invest in protective eyewear. This often gets overlooked as being unimportant when beginners start purchasing golf equipment. Golf is primarily played outside in the elements, however. Your eyes can become seriously damaged if left unprotected. It can also be easier to see where your ball is going or where you want it to go if you don't have to constantly shield your eyes.
